目录

Java控制台带参数

C++控制台带参数


Java控制台带参数

这里Java如下代码:

public static void main(String[] args) throws InterruptedException, IOException, SQLException, ClassNotFoundException, TimeoutException {System.out.println("XXXXXXXXXX XXXXXXXXXX XXXXXXXXXX XXXXXXXXXX XXXXXXXXXX XXXXXXXXXX");if(args.length != 8){System.out.println("parameter error!!!!");return;}String XXXXXXXXXX = args[0];String XXXXXXXXXX = args[1];String XXXXXXXXXX = args[2];String XXXXXXXXXX = args[3];String XXXXXXXXXX = args[4];String XXXXXXXXXX = args[5];String XXXXXXXXXX = args[6];String XXXXXXXXXX = args[7];
}

通过这种方式,就可以从命令行的客户端,获取用户的输入,这里在ip地址,端口,用户名,密码等方面,使用得比较多。

C++控制台带参数

如下的main函数:

int main(int argc, char** argv)
{if(argc != 4){qDebug() << "The paramenter error!";qDebug() << "XXXXXX XXXXXX XXXXXX XXXXXX XXXXXX";return 0;}QString XXXXXX= QString(argv[1]);QString XXXXXX= QString(argv[2]);QString XXXXXX= QString(argv[3]);
}

这里和Java不同的是,argv[0]为参数的个数,如果要想得到用户的输入,得从argv[1]中获取,才可以。

Java|C++工作笔记-控制台带参数运行程序相关推荐

  1. java控制台编译_【java c#】通过控制台编译和运行程序//不依赖IDE

    今天闲来无事,回顾下通过控制台编译和运行程序//不依赖IDE java篇 1)首先安装好jdk,然后配置下编译器环境,如下: 将默认路径C:\Program Files\Java\jdk1.6.0\b ...

  2. Intellij IDEA带参数运行

    Intellij IDEA带参数运行 转自:http://blog.csdn.net/silentwolfyh/article/details/51491462 [python] view plain ...

  3. MapReduce工作笔记——Job调度参数设置

    文章目录 1. JobName 2. Reduce的个数 3. Job的task并发数 4. 设置Job的失败比例 5. 设置Job的优先级 6. 设置task的超时时间 7. 预测执行 MapRed ...

  4. 牛皮!这份GitHub上标星90.6K的Java面试指南+笔记,带你搞定96%的java面试

    前言 今年受疫情影响,面试难度增大,工作很难找,从延迟的金三银四,裁员的企业.人数众多的金九银十等方方面面都可以看得出来 今天,我们要分享的是,GitHub上标星90.6K的Java面试指南+笔记,这 ...

  5. Alibaba内部Java技术成长笔记,业界良心,程序员最爱

    前言 根据数据表明,阿里巴巴已经连续3年获评最受欢迎的中国互联网公司,实际上阿里巴巴无论在科技创新力还是社会创造价值这几个方面,都是具有一定代表里的.在行业内,很多互联网企业也将阿里作为自己的标杆,越 ...

  6. Qt工作笔记-使用Qt Creator运行和调试运行结果不一样(参数没有初始化)

    使用的版本是Qt5.7 编译器为WinGW 同样的代码: 运行的时候: 这边显示的是开关, 在程序里面调试运行的时候: 又正常了, 这真是日了狗的操作! 真是奇特的操作啊! 找到给变量赋值的语句: 用 ...

  7. Qt笔记-QProcess带管道符号运行及获取进程启动时间(Linux)

    这里不能用直接写到QProcess中start中的command参数. 比如这样的shell: ps -eo pid,lstart | grep 1808 采用这样的方式: QProcess p; p ...

  8. 工作74:vue带参数跳转其他页面

    1.准备好两个vue文件 panda.vue travel.vue 2.写index.js配置文件 import travel from '@/components/travel' 1 {path: ...

  9. ...is public, should be declared in a file named “ScresourcesApplic.java“---springcloud工作笔记164

    Class 'ScresourcesApplication' is public, should be declared in a file named 'ScresourcesApplication ...

最新文章

  1. 牛客练习赛81 B. 小 Q 与彼岸花(FWT nlogn做法)
  2. Qt Style Sheet 翻译(中)--类似css
  3. apt-get常用命令
  4. 如何通过BIPlatform完成多维报表以及图形配置
  5. Client does not support authentication protocol requested by server;
  6. kubeadm reset后安装遇到的错误:Unable to connect to the server: x509: certificate signed by unknown authority
  7. 常见web漏洞验证攻略(萌新入坑必备!)
  8. HiccDS共享音乐列表
  9. Object C学习笔记11-数组
  10. hdu 六度分离 floyd
  11. axis2 wsdl2java 报错_解决webService+axis2生成的wsdl文件有两个Bindings/Endpoint 的问题
  12. OpenCV Error: Insufficient memory问题解析
  13. 一个完整的c语言程序~~简单的实例
  14. 在centos系统上安装python
  15. 赏析角度有哪些_名句鉴赏题从哪些角度入手鉴赏?一线名师告诉你:五个角度...
  16. java applepay_【苹果支付】添加ApplePay的支持
  17. 计算机毕设 SpringBoot 校园志愿者管理系统 志愿者管理系统 志愿者信息管理系统Java Vue MySQL数据库 远程调试 代码讲解
  18. 微软ad域服务器 管理用户,威联通NAS助企业解决Windows AD域账户管理
  19. 阿里云飞天系统质效管理体系入选信通院“软件质效领航者”优秀案例
  20. UE4.27 基于composure的虚拟制片

热门文章

  1. Mysql主主同步详细操作过程
  2. UNIX网络编程——进程间通信概述
  3. 打开网页出现“安全沙箱冲突”的提示
  4. shell检查硬盘分区空间
  5. 深度解析vsftpd服务
  6. 手把手教你用C语言画“心”!
  7. 如何从0-1制作数据大屏,我用大白话给你解释清楚了
  8. 为什么需要python?它在人工智能与机器学习的优势是什么?
  9. 比以前更帅气了的飞鸽传书
  10. 别具一格的HAO3GP整站源码花坛